使用jQuery添加天数可以通过以下步骤实现:
datepicker
插件来选择日期。datepicker
插件提供了一个用户友好的日历界面,可以方便地选择日期。首先,确保你已经引入了datepicker
插件的库文件。可以通过以下方式在HTML文件中引入datepicker
插件:<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/datepicker/dist/datepicker.min.css">
<script src="https://cdn.jsdelivr.net/npm/datepicker/dist/datepicker.min.js"></script>datepicker
插件初始化文本框,并设置日期格式。例如,设置日期格式为"yyyy-mm-dd":$(document).ready(function() {
$('#datepicker').datepicker({
format: 'yyyy-mm-dd'
});
});click
事件监听器来捕获按钮的点击事件,并获取选择的日期和要添加的天数。然后,使用JavaScript的Date
对象的setDate
方法来添加天数,并将结果显示在页面上。例如:$(document).ready(function() {
$('#addDaysButton').click(function() {
var selectedDate = $('#datepicker').datepicker('getDate');
var numberOfDays = 7; // 要添加的天数
selectedDate.setDate(selectedDate.getDate() + numberOfDays);
var formattedDate = selectedDate.getFullYear() + '-' + (selectedDate.getMonth() + 1) + '-' + selectedDate.getDate();
$('#result').text('添加天数后的日期为:' + formattedDate);
});
});这样,当用户选择日期并点击"添加天数"按钮时,页面上会显示添加指定天数后的日期。
请注意,以上代码示例中使用的是jQuery的datepicker
插件来选择日期,并使用JavaScript的Date
对象来处理日期计算。如果你需要使用其他日期选择插件或日期计算库,可以根据具体情况进行调整。
领取专属 10元无门槛券
手把手带您无忧上云